Output 509dbfc678146a38d1bd685159b8bbcc496be5a4bf34a3384c77ff459aff2e86:26

value
258170247
script pubkey
OP_0 OP_PUSHBYTES_20 8fab163142c8abae35155e9e3e7fd3009455f9f8
address
bc1q3743vv2zez46udg4t60rul7nqz29t70crqk5zy
transaction
509dbfc678146a38d1bd685159b8bbcc496be5a4bf34a3384c77ff459aff2e86